Assign Contour Elevation-From Contour Labels
Function
This command allows you to set elevations to contours from elevation
labels.
Select a sample of the elevation text to be used on the contouring.
Next, select a sample of the contouring that you want to add the
elevations to. Now select all the contours and their corresponding
elevation labels and press <Enter>. Carlson TakeOff will then add
elevations to all the contours. You may be prompted to distinguish
what contour goes with what elevation label. You can either press
<Enter> to accept the contour that Carlson TakeOff has selected
or you can Press <N> to choose another contour.
Prompts
Select sample of elevation text:
Select sample of a contour line:
Select contour lines and elevation
text to process.
Select objects: all
5049 found
4041 were filtered out.
Select objects:
Joining adjacent polylines...
Reading the selection set ...
Joining ...
Pre-processing entity #1008 of 1008
Filtering text entities
Processing elevation text #518
Conflict detected: pick contour
corresponding to current elevation text
Press N for next selection or Enter to
accept current:
Remaking polyline #311
Keyboard Command:
TXTCELEV
Prerequisite:
contours and contours labels
